KUALA LUMPUR, March 5 -- Gleneagles Kuala Lumpur and Sunway Medical Centre in Petaling Jaya have been named the top 250 hospitals in the world by Newsweek in collaboration with Statista for the annual ranking of the world's best hospital.

According to the report, the list included data on 2,400 hospitals across 30 countries, including the US, most of Western Europe, 10 Asian countries and Scandinavia.

For the first time, Malaysia and Chile were added to the ranking.

The Gleneagles Kuala Lumpur and Sunway Medical Centre Petaling Jaya ranked 223 and 233 respectively.

The top 10 healthcare centres on the list were dominated by hospitals from the US, Canada, Germany, Sweden, France, Israel and Switzerland.
